Exxon to pay spill penalty interest
Elizabeth Bluemink Anchorage Daily News
Exxon Mobil Corp. said June 29 it won’t appeal nearly $500 million in interest that a court recently ordered it to pay to Alaska fishermen, business owners and others harmed by the 1989 Exxon Valdez oil spill.
